The benefit of ES5 web browser APIs with callbacks is that it's super explicit once we understand how it works under the hood. by @willsentance @FrontendMasters #javasript #javascriptTheHardParts #100DaysOfCode #developer_tips
The problem with ES5 web browser APIs with callback functions is that our response data is only available in the callback function - callback hell. by @willsentance @FrontendMasters #javascript #javascriptTheHardParts #100DaysOfCode #developer_tips
Features 'web browsers' have that JavaScript does not have. - Dev-tools - Console - sockets - network request - HTML DOM - Timer by @willsentance @FrontendMasters #javascript #javascriptTheHardParts #100DaysOfCode #developer_tips
#javascript does not have the ability to speak to the internet. It's not a feature of #javascript. It's the web browser that makes network requests. by @willsentance @FrontendMasters #javascriptTheHardPart #100DaysOfCode #developer_tips
